Facility in Lexington, KY seeking CRNA locums coverage
Rates: $250/hr
Opportunity Highlights
-
Consistent Schedule: Work a full-time, 4x10-hour schedule, from 10 AM to 8:30 PM, with a 30-minute lunch. You MUST be available to work four weeks per month. The facility will prioritize candidates with availability for these shifts.
-
Diverse Caseload: The role involves covering a variety of services, including Ortho, Trauma, Vascular, and Neuro cases (no Heart or OB). You can expect to see an average of 1-9 patients per day, with a patient population spanning all ages (excluding neonates).
-
Collaborative Environment: You will be medically directed by an anesthesiologist. The typical ratio is 1:2 or 1:3 (anesthesiologists to CRNA) for low-acuity cases, and 1:4. You will not work solo.
-
EMR System: The facility uses Epic for all charting; Epic experience is preferred.
-
Required Skills: You should be proficient in procedures such as intubation, central line placement, and arterial line placement. You will also be required to work in the NORA (Non-Operating Room Anesthesia) setting.
-
Willing to License: The facility is willing to license qualified candidates.
-
Quick Privileging: The credentialing timeframe is approximately 90 days.
